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Essentials of Metal Polishing - In most cases, the finishing of metal is required for aesthetics as well as clean-room applications. It's one of the more recognized treatments simply because of its usefulness in enhancing the natural attractiveness of the item, such as, cookware, auto parts or motor bike parts. Besides that, a large number of clean-rooms demand a lustrous finish so to minimize the perviousness of the metal surfaces that could cause particles to collect and contaminate. A really good example of this usage might be in vacuum chambers. There are actually a great number of methods of finish metal, and we can take a look at a few of the processes involved. Metal may be finished manually, using purpose made bu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A polishing paste or compound is typically employed, which can incorporate tripoli, dolomite, limestone, chalk,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, because of its mediocre th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scidness, and hardness is usually one of the most time intensive. Opposite of that scenario, goods made out of non-ferrous metals are certainly more amenable to buffing, because these need the least number of operations.
Where a high processing quality isn't really called for, faster pad speeds may be used. A decreased pad speed is utilized in the event that a superior mirror finish is called for. Polishing buffs plastered with paste can be appreciably affected by the force on the pad. The concentration of the surface pressure might be elevated to a specific limit, although applying above the maximum level of pressure not simply lowers the quality of the procedure, but also can degrade performance, can bring about wear on the part, and there is furthermore an evident overheating of the work-pieces, as a result of friction. When polishing thin objects, it will be raised temperature (and the relating bendability of the metal) that will oftentimes cause materials to flex, warp or buckle. In general, it will take a seasoned technician to think about each one of these points to both not cause damage to the part and to work correctly. To be able to appreciably boost the quality of the resulting surface, the polishing operation really should be done with a lesser amount of vigour and not so much pressure so that you will consequently complete a surface with no scores or fine lines left behind by the finishing process, subsequently arriving at a shiny mirror finish.
